Zig Zag Indicator

Code Zig Zag.mq4


//+------------------------------------------------------------------+
//| Custom Moving Average.mq4 |
//| Copyright © 2005, MetaQuotes Software Corp. |
//| http://www.metaquotes.net/ |
//+------------------------------------------------------------------+
#property copyright "Copyright © 2005, MetaQuotes Software Corp."
#property link      "http://www.metaquotes.net/"

#property indicator_chart_window
#property indicator_buffers 1
#property indicator_color1 Red
//---- indicator parameters
extern int ExtDepth=12; extern int ExtDeviation=5; extern int ExtBackstep=3; //---- indicator buffers
double ExtMapBuffer[]; double ExtMapBuffer2[]; //+------------------------------------------------------------------+
//| Custom indicator initialization function |
//+------------------------------------------------------------------+
int init()
  {
   IndicatorBuffers(2); //---- drawing settings
   SetIndexStyle(0,DRAW_SECTION); //---- indicator buffers mapping
   SetIndexBuffer(0,ExtMapBuffer); SetIndexBuffer(1,ExtMapBuffer2); SetIndexEmptyValue(0,0.0); //---- indicator short name
   IndicatorShortName("ZigZag("+ExtDepth+","+ExtDeviation+","+ExtBackstep+")"); //---- initialization done
   return(0); }
//+------------------------------------------------------------------+
//| |
//+------------------------------------------------------------------+
int start()
  {
   int    shift, back,lasthighpos,lastlowpos; double val,res; double curlow,curhigh,lasthigh,lastlow; for(shift=Bars-ExtDepth; shift>=0; shift--)
     {
      val=Low[Lowest(NULL,0,MODE_LOW,ExtDepth,shift)]; if(val==lastlow) val=0.0; else
        {
         lastlow=val; if((Low[shift]-val)>(ExtDeviation*Point)) val=0.0; else
           {
            for(back=1; back<=ExtBackstep; back++)
              {
               res=ExtMapBuffer[shift+back]; if((res!=0)&&(res>val)) ExtMapBuffer[shift+back]=0.0; }
           }
        }
      ExtMapBuffer[shift]=val; //--- high
      val=High[Highest(NULL,0,MODE_HIGH,ExtDepth,shift)]; if(val==lasthigh) val=0.0; else
        {
         lasthigh=val; if((val-High[shift])>(ExtDeviation*Point)) val=0.0; else
           {
            for(back=1; back<=ExtBackstep; back++)
              {
               res=ExtMapBuffer2[shift+back]; if((res!=0)&&(res<val)) ExtMapBuffer2[shift+back]=0.0; }
           }
        }
      ExtMapBuffer2[shift]=val; }

   // final cutting
   lasthigh=-1; lasthighpos=-1; lastlow=-1; lastlowpos=-1; for(shift=Bars-ExtDepth; shift>=0; shift--)
     {
      curlow=ExtMapBuffer[shift]; curhigh=ExtMapBuffer2[shift]; if((curlow==0)&&(curhigh==0)) continue; //---
      if(curhigh!=0)
        {
         if(lasthigh>0)
           {
            if(lasthigh<curhigh) ExtMapBuffer2[lasthighpos]=0; else ExtMapBuffer2[shift]=0; }
         //---
         if(lasthigh<curhigh || lasthigh<0)
           {
            lasthigh=curhigh; lasthighpos=shift; }
         lastlow=-1; }
      //----
      if(curlow!=0)
        {
         if(lastlow>0)
           {
            if(lastlow>curlow) ExtMapBuffer[lastlowpos]=0; else ExtMapBuffer[shift]=0; }
         //---
         if((curlow<lastlow)||(lastlow<0))
           {
            lastlow=curlow; lastlowpos=shift; }
         lasthigh=-1; }
     }
 
   for(shift=Bars-1; shift>=0; shift--)
     {
      if(shift>=Bars-ExtDepth) ExtMapBuffer[shift]=0.0; else
        {
         res=ExtMapBuffer2[shift]; if(res!=0.0) ExtMapBuffer[shift]=res; }
     }
  }
